The Hondo Two-Handed Sword is a powerful two-handed sword in Crimson Desert hidden inside Lion Crest Manor on the western side of the City of Hernand. The sword is locked inside a chest behind an inner door that requires a key purchased from a separate back-alley vendor in the starting region, making it one of the earliest two-handers in the game that demands a small amount of cross-region preparation before it can be claimed.
On pickup, the Hondo carries three Abyss Core slots pre-loaded with Critical Rate I, Stamina Siphon I, and Attack I, giving it a strong combat profile from the moment it is equipped. It is widely treated as a carry weapon for the early-to-mid game; players who only grab one hidden two-hander before the first major story milestone tend to pick this one.
Because it sits inside a manor patrolled by hostile guards and requires a key not sold by any of the standard town vendors, the Hondo is one of the more deliberate hidden weapon pickups in the early game. Players who walk in through the front door of Lion Crest Manor never see it. The intended path bypasses the front entrance entirely.

The three pre-loaded Abyss Cores and the slot configuration are the load-bearing reason most players prioritize this pickup over comparable two-handers found in the same region.
Acquiring the Hondo Two-Handed Sword is a three-step pickup that begins in the starting region and ends inside Lion Crest Manor.
Before traveling north to the manor, stop by the windmill near Mock Root Ranch in the starting region. Underneath the windmill is the Back-Alley Vendor at Mock Root Windmill, who sells the locked-door key required for the inner door inside the manor outhouse. Buy any keys the vendor has in stock at the same time; several open chests and doors elsewhere on the map, and returning later is a longer round trip than the silver cost.
Travel north to Lion Crest Manor. The estate is heavily patrolled by guards and entering through the front entrance triggers a combat encounter that is unnecessary for this pickup. Instead, circle around the outside of the property and look for a small outhouse along the side or rear of the building.
The outhouse has a wooden window near the top. Climb up the wall toward it, wait for the on-screen E prompt, and hop through. Inside, you land in a small interior space with an inner door that the purchased key unlocks.
After unlocking and opening the inner door, you will see a Glenmore Sword lying on the floor. That is not the prize. Walk past it to the chest in the room and loot the Hondo Two-Handed Sword. The chest contains the sword with its three Abyss Cores already installed.
The Hondo functions as a high-output two-handed sword whose pre-installed cores cover three of the most important early-game stat lines at once:
Critical Rate I boosts the chance of a critical hit on every attack, which scales especially well with the wider swing arcs of two-handed weapons.
Stamina Siphon I returns stamina on hits, letting the wielder sustain longer combo strings without running dry during sustained boss damage windows.
Attack I adds a flat damage modifier that compounds with the other two cores on every successful hit.
Because the Hondo occupies both weapon slots, it cannot be paired with a one-handed off-hand the way the Legionary's Gladius, Hollow Visage, or Survivor's Solitude can. Many players carry it as the boss-window pick on their weapon wheel and swap to a one-handed dual-wield pair for trash clear.
Visit the back-alley vendor first. The trip is wasted if you arrive at the manor without the key in inventory.
Approach the outhouse from the outside walls of the property. The front gate is not part of the intended path.
Save before climbing in. If the climb angle fails the first time, the E prompt does not always pop on a second approach until you reposition.
Do not engage the manor guards if the goal is only the Hondo. Stealth or sprinting back out through the outhouse window is faster than fighting through the building.
